Manual fire alarm boxes shall be _____ in color?

Explanation:
Manual fire alarm boxes are colored red to ensure immediate, universal recognition as emergency signaling devices. Red stands out against typical building backgrounds and is the standard color used by fire codes (such as NFPA 72 and NFPA 101) to indicate devices that initiate a fire alarm manually. This color convention helps occupants and responders locate the pull boxes quickly during an emergency, reducing response time. Other colors, like blue, green, or yellow, are used for different systems or indications, but they are not the recognized color for manual fire alarm boxes. Red provides the clearest, most unambiguous cue for activating an alarm.
